Marro & Sons Sanitation is an active carrier based out of Marlboro, New York. Marro & Sons Sanitation operates under USDOT number 1142024. Marro & Sons Sanitation has 5 tractors and employs 3 drivers. Marro & Sons Sanitation is authorized to operate Intrastate Non-Hazmat cargo.